Does anyone know the best schema to achieve a multi-level category system?

I need a person to be able to add categories on the fly, but then also specify sub categories and even possibly sub-categories of sub-cats. I have found two possible ways inside one table with using parentID, groupID, etc. But the issue I am now running into is that I have to sort on groupID to get the items to "group" correctly when showing in a HTML drop down list. Which means I can't sort alphabetically. If I do the order is not right...using Lasso 6 with some looping code to indent the subs in the list. On top of that I would also like the ability to assign a priority field for listing in that order as well. There has to be some kind of solution to this that I don't see.
